The first Tarzan I saw was in the old black and white series,
starring Johnny Weizmueler. He'd been a noted swimming
champion and was picked for his swimming abilities and
physique and not much else at first. You'll note he wasn't much
of an actor. But he had star quality. His loin cloth was larger
and it did show he had on a short tight suit underneath on one
occasion I saw. In the comic strip way back when I was young
he also wore a loin cloth of course. He probably wore one
since many of the native tribes wore them also. From early
National Geographic magazine pictures, tribespeople had modesty in some form back then, and he learned to dress accordingly. And it did offer some protection from maybe nasty rope and tree limb burns.
But as a kid, no he didn't wear a nappy. All babies
like to run and play in the nude. Ever notice after bath time LOL? If anything, he made his own thatched covering long
before he had access to a real loin cloth. He just started out
with something primitive for the natives' sake, and then learned from the natives about upgrading to something longer
lasting later on as he developed.
